How do I understand my energy bill?

Asked 2 months ago
Understanding your energy bill can initially seem daunting, but breaking it down into key components can make the process much easier. An energy bill generally includes several important sections that contribute to the total amount due. Firstly, there is the summary section, which highlights your account information, billing period, and total amount owed. This is where you can find the due date and any previous payments. Secondly, the usage details provide insights into your energy consumption during the billing period, often compared to previous months or similar periods in the past year. This can help you track patterns in your energy usage. Next, there are charges related to your energy consumption. This usually includes the base fee, any variable rates per kilowatt-hour, and possibly additional fees for services or delivery. Additionally, there may be taxes and environmental or renewable energy charges listed. Lastly, many utility companies provide tips for energy conservation or information on available programs.
